It all began in 2021, with a never-ending line at the Uptown Phoenix Farmers Market.

Brandon Gioffre and Michele Gioffre, New York natives with Calabrese roots, brought the Italian food they grew up on to the market, hand-pulling fresh mozzarella, filling cannoli to order, and preparing recipes passed down through generations.

What started as a small stand quickly built a loyal following, drawn to something people recognized instantly and kept coming back for.

In 2022, they took a chance on a small neighborhood café in the heart of Scottsdale, expanding the menu to include dishes like arancini, clams oreganata, chicken scarpariello, and house-made lasagna. Everything is and always will be made from scratch using high-quality ingredients, with a clear focus on doing things the way they’re done in old-school New York Italian kitchens.

Frank DiMaggio, a local developer, former professional baseball player, and part of the DiMaggio family legacy, first visited as a guest and immediately recognized what was being built. That visit—alongside his wife and acclaimed designer Lauren Wallace—evolved into a partnership, grounded in a shared vision and the belief that this kind of Italian dining was missing here.

In 2024, the restaurant was reintroduced as DiMaggio’s Italian Restaurant, reimagined to reflect the timeless character and spirit of old-school New York Italian dining in a space where everyone feels welcome.

We continue to operate at the same standard we started with: traditional recipes, high-quality ingredients, and an experience people return to again and again. Today, Executive Chef Brandon Gioffre still hand-pulls fresh mozzarella in-house each morning.

The Uptown Phoenix Farmers Market stand remains part of our story, and is still going strong every Saturday morning.
